Historic Cullinan Document Fetches $28K

By Rapaport News / May 02, 2019 / www.diamonds.net / Article Link

RAPAPORT... The original manuscript that paved the way for the cuttingof the 3,106-carat Cullinan diamond to create the British Crown Jewels fetchedmore than seven times its high estimate at Bonhams. The sale included the documents representatives of KingEdward VII and London diamond brokers M.J. Levy & Nephew signed in 1908, aswell as a paste replica of the Cullinan diamond in its original rough form. Tworeplica sets of the nine principal diamonds that form the Crown Jewels alsofeatured in the collection at the London sale Tuesday. The entire group sold for GBP 21,312 ($27,845) against its highvaluation of GBP 3,000 ($3,900), after a bidding war between live, online andphone buyers, the auction house said.
